Podcast: Don Mills On Building Communities Through Business And Volunteerism
In this week’s episode of the “Insights” podcast, we turn the microphone around. Don Mills was recently inducted into the Nova Scotia Business Hall of Fame – an honour he received because of a successful business career where he built a firm with more than 600 employees and his extensive volunteerism including stints on the boards of the IWK, Halifax Partnership, Halifax Chamber of Commerce, APEC, among many others.
Don provides insights on how he dealt with adversity, the importance of volunteerism and why he spends much of his time these days promoting a new vision for Atlantic Canada.

The “Insights” podcast combines the experiences of an economist, David Campbell, and a social scientist, Don Mills, to explore the challenges and opportunities facing Atlantic Canada, promote data-driven decision-making among policymakers, and encourage a wider dialogue and debate leading to greater prosperity for the region.
